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21580822 72039750198 83378
22384482650 7891587140
22384482650 7891587140
8206612970 7127 31 03
All about undefined
Interested in learning more?
22384482650 7891587140
8206612970 7127 31 03
See more
00 946507
79526371877 238 34483
See more
4658656333 7831 310265272
684 87317553 54115545392
See more